Learn how Build Mode works in Paralives, including tool categories, navigation, shortcuts, object controls, grid mode, and useful beginner building tips.
To open Build Mode, click the house icon in the bottom-left corner of the screen. You can also press B on your keyboard as a shortcut.
Each tab in the side menu opens its own objects, with submenus for more specific categories.
Build (B): Tools for the main structure of your build, including walls, windows, stairs, roofs, and fences.
Rooms: Browse items by room type, such as kitchen, bathroom, bedroom, or living room.
Furnishings (O): Browse items by object type, such as furniture, lighting, appliances, decor, and clutter.
Terrain Tools: Landscape and shape outdoor areas with nature items, terrain sculpting, painting, and flattening tools.
Search (Ctrl + F): Find specific items quickly without browsing every category.
Cursor Mode selects an item so you can move, resize, rotate, or edit it.
Sledgehammer (K) deletes anything highlighted in red, such as walls, furniture, or other build items.
Pipette (I) shows the selected item information and copies it so you can place another one.
Bulldoze clears everything on the lot. This cannot be undone, so use it carefully.
Undo (Ctrl + Z) reverses the last action.
Redo (Ctrl + Y) restores the last action you undid.
Levels (Page Up / Page Down) moves the view up or down between floors.
View (Home / End) changes the wall visibility mode, controlling how walls are shown on screen.
Some Build Mode items have extra versions you can choose from. These variants may change the item’s shape, layout, size, or related style, depending on the object.
You may find variants in two places:
In the catalog
Some item cards show small symbols or dots. Clicking these opens a variant gallery, where you can choose from related versions of that item.
From the item menu
After placing or selecting an item, check the item toolbar at the bottom. Some objects have a pencil icon that lets you choose an alternate version of the selected item.
Item swatches let you customise the look and details of selected objects. After selecting an item, open the swatch options to change colours, materials, or style variations. Some objects also include extra settings. For example, lights may let you adjust the light colour and brightness.
When you select an item, Paralives may show resize controls around it. Depending on the object, you may see handles or arrows that let you adjust the item’s size horizontally, vertically, or in a specific direction.
Some items have simple resize controls, while others need the Advanced Transform Tool if you want more detailed size and position changes. You can open the Advanced Transform Tool from the item toolbar at the bottom of the screen, or press * on your keyboard to turn it on or off.

When you are placing walls or fences, the grid helps you line things up and create a cleaner floor plan. You can use the grid or turn it off when you want more freedom with placement.
When grid mode is on, walls and fences follow the grid lines. Press G to turn the grid on or off.
You can also hold Shift while placing or adjusting walls and fences to use a smaller grid size. This helps you create more detailed floor plans while still keeping things lined up.
Changing the Grid Direction
If you want the grid to follow the direction of an existing wall, select the wall and choose: Start placing walls on a 1x1m grid aligned with this wall
Creating a Custom Grid Size
You can also make the grid size match the length of a wall. First, build a wall, then select that wall piece, open the three-dot menu, and choose: Start placing walls on a grid of the length of this wall
